Konvoy Holdings Pty Limited has entered receivership, with sale and recapitalisation proceedings now underway, following an appointment by secured creditor EQT Structured Finance Services Pty Ltd.
Keith Crawford and Robert Smith of McGrathNicol were appointed Receivers and Managers for Konvoy and its Australian subsidiaries, with Keith Crawford and Andrew Grenfell also appointed Receivers for Konvoy’s New Zealand subsidiary. This follows the appointment of Chris Hill, Joseph Hansell, and Paul Harlond of FTI Consulting as Voluntary Administrators for Konvoy, and Joseph Hansell and David McGrath of FTI Consulting as Voluntary Administrators for Konvoy NZ.
Konvoy, a leading keg rental and technology-enabled keg fleet management business in Australasia, will continue to operate as usual under the control of the Receivers. The Receivers are working to ensure minimal disruption to employees, customers, and suppliers while progressing with the sale and recapitalisation process for Konvoy Kegs.

As part of the receivership proceedings, the Receivers will be launching a formal sale and/or recapitalisation process for Konvoy Kegs.
